Champion Homes recently held its second quarter fiscal 2025 earnings call, revealing a quarter marked by effective execution and strategic advancements. The company reported a strong growth in home sales, enhancing its digital direct-to-consumer strategy and advancing the integration of Regional Homes acquisition. These efforts have positioned Champion Homes to deliver more value to its customers and strengthen its market position.

A Strong Quarter of Growth and Resilience

Mark Yost, Champion Homes President and CEO, highlighted the company's strong performance in the second quarter. Home sales increased by 29% year-over-year, reaching 6,536 units, with a 14% increase in organic sales orders. However, hurricane impacts disrupted both orders and sales, causing a 12 million decrease in revenue from the fiscal first quarter. Despite these challenges, Champion Homes' backlog grew by 23 million, totaling 427 million at the end of the quarter.

A Milestone Acquisition and Strategic Partnerships

The acquisition of Regional Homes has surpassed expectations, with Champion Homes achieving the upper limit of its synergy targets ahead of schedule. Additionally, the collaboration with Triad Financial for Champion Financing has gained significant momentum, launching new floor plan financing options for independent dealers and consumer client financing programs for selected national products. These initiatives have bolstered Champion Homes' commitment to enhancing financing accessibility and driving growth in the manufactured housing market.

Looking Ahead: Challenges and Opportunities

Champion Homes anticipates a modest decline in top-line performance for the third fiscal quarter due to operational disruptions from Hurricane Helene and Milton. However, the company remains optimistic about the long-term demand within the affected regions, positioning itself to support the rebuilding efforts and capitalize on growth opportunities. The company's strong cash position and strategic initiatives, including M&A priorities and direct-to-consumer strategies, are expected to drive continued growth.
